

本文為英文版的機器翻譯版本，如內容有任何歧義或不一致之處，概以英文版為準。

# 搭配 使用 EventBridge AWS Elemental MediaConvert
<a name="eventbridge_events"></a>

您可以使用 Amazon EventBridge 來監控您的 AWS Elemental MediaConvert 任務。以下是您可以使用 EventBridge 執行的操作的一些範例：

**取得任務輸出的詳細資訊**  
AWS Elemental MediaConvert 在 `COMPLETE` 事件的通知中提供任務輸出的詳細資訊。此資訊包括任務的媒體檔案和資訊清單的位置和檔案名稱。如需詳細資訊，請參閱[具有 COMPLETE 狀態的事件](ev_status_complete.md)。  
如需傳送至 Amazon CloudWatch 的任務指標資訊，請參閱 [搭配 MediaConvert 使用 CloudWatch](cloudwatch_metrics.md)。

**設定任務狀態變更的電子郵件通知**  
若要設定 EventBridge 事件規則，請參閱 [教學課程：設定失敗任務的電子郵件通知](setting-up-cloudwatch-event-rules.md#mediaconvert_sns_tutorial)。  
如需您可以設定事件規則的任務狀態變更通知詳細資訊，請參閱 [MediaConvert EventBridge 事件的清單](mediaconvert_event_list.md)。

**監控任務的進度**  
`STATUS_UPDATE` 事件提供您的任務所處階段的相關資訊 (`PROBING`、`TRANSCODING` 和 `UPLOADING`)。對於某些任務，MediaConvert 會提供任務進度的預估值。此預估會以從任務離開佇列到輸出檔案出現在輸出 Amazon S3 儲存貯體的總時間百分比顯示。  
如需有關 `STATUS_UPDATE` 事件的詳細資訊，請參閱 [MediaConvert EventBridge 事件的清單](mediaconvert_event_list.md) 的事件類型表格。  
如需有關調整狀態更新頻率的詳細資訊，請參閱 [調整狀態更新間隔](adjusting-the-status-update-interval.md)。

**使用 AWS Lambda 函數自動啟動後製處理**  
您可以設定 EventBridge，讓 AWS Lambda 函數在任務完成後啟動您的後置處理程式碼。如需 AWS Lambda 搭配 使用 的詳細資訊 AWS Elemental MediaConvert，請參閱下列其中一個資源：  
+ 如需經驗豐富的雲端架構師，請參閱 *AWS 答案*部落格上的[隨需影片 AWS](https://aws.amazon.com/solutions/video-on-demand-on-aws/)文章。
+ 如需 MediaConvert 和 Lambda 的新開發人員，請參閱 GitHub 上的[使用 Lambda 自動化 MediaConvert 任務](https://github.com/aws-samples/aws-media-services-simple-vod-workflow/blob/master/7-MediaConvertJobLambda/README.md)教學課程。

**取得您建立之任務或其他 MediaConvert 操作的詳細資訊**  
根據預設，MediaConvert 不會針對您建立的新任務或您執行的任何其他 MediaConvert 操作發出 EventBridge 事件。若要在這些情況下接收 EventBridge 事件，您必須先建立 AWS CloudTrail 追蹤。  
如需詳細資訊，請參閱[使用 CloudTrail 追蹤](https://docs.aws.amazon.com/awscloudtrail/latest/userguide/cloudtrail-getting-started.html)。

**注意**  
EventBridge 會從 MediaConvert 事件串流傳遞每個事件至少一次。  
MediaConvert 不需要任何額外的許可，即可將事件交付至 EventBridge。

**Topics**
+ [設定 EventBridge 規則](setting-up-cloudwatch-event-rules.md)
+ [監控 MediaConvert 任務進度](how-mediaconvert-jobs-progress.md)
+ [MediaConvert EventBridge 事件的清單](mediaconvert_event_list.md)